Two calculators, one real result
Feeding a ₹800 cost price into the markup calculator at 25% gives a ₹200 markup amount and a ₹1,000 selling price. Feeding the identical ₹800 cost price into the margin calculator at 20% gives a ₹200 profit amount and the same ₹1,000 selling price. Same sale, same rupee profit, two calculators, two different-looking percentages.
Why markup% is always higher than margin% for the same sale
The ₹200 profit is a fixed rupee amount, but the two percentages measure it against different bases: markup divides it by the smaller cost price (₹200 ÷ ₹800 = 25%), while margin divides it by the larger selling price (₹200 ÷ ₹1,000 = 20%). Dividing the same numerator by a larger denominator always gives a smaller percentage — so margin% is mathematically guaranteed to be lower than markup% whenever there's any profit at all.
The pattern holds at a different scale: ₹700 cost, 30% margin
A ₹700 cost price with a 30% margin produces a ₹1,000 selling price and a ₹300 profit. That same ₹300 profit on the same ₹700 cost is a 42.8571% markup — feeding costPrice=700 and markupPct=42.8571 into the markup calculator returns the identical ₹1,000 selling price and ₹300 profit, confirming the relationship holds regardless of the numbers chosen.
Why this matters when comparing pricing across suppliers or teams
If one supplier quotes pricing in markup% and another in margin%, comparing the raw numbers directly is misleading — a 25% markup and a 20% margin might be the exact same deal, as shown above, while a 25% margin is actually a much higher markup (33.33%) and a meaningfully more expensive one. Converting both to the same basis (or just comparing the resulting selling prices directly) avoids that confusion.
